Coffee Shop No. 512 Through Grace San Antonio, TX June 10, 2015 By the time I reached Through Grace, I had already consumed four cortados and a latte. I almost walked past, but something nudged me to step inside—and I’m so glad I did. Out of the 15 coffee shops I visited in San Antonio, this was by far the warmest welcome I received from a barista. This is the kind of shop I’d dream of opening if I ever opened one myself. Faith-inspired, with uplifting scriptures on the walls, it’s the perfect spot for a Bible study, catching up with friends, or simply enjoying a quiet solo moment. The atmosphere is light, inviting, and spotless, and the barista went out of her way to engage with every single person who walked through the door. I left with more than just a delicious cortado. I walked away with t-shirts covered in encouraging words, a heart lifted by the experience, and a reminder to put God first and love others well. Enjoying life one cortado at a time!

After a Google maps search of "coffee near me", we stopped in today and are glad we did. The staff was very friendly and helpful. The atmosphere is relaxed, light and clean. The coffee drinks are excellent! Not only are they actually served hot, they are delicious. The pastries were great as well. I feel it's worth mentioning, as most can conclude from the business name, this great coffee shop is heavy on Christian themes, however ALL are welcomed equally. Do yourself a big favor and check them out. You won't regret it.

This place has a really cute atmosphere and the staff is very friendly. Unfortunately, it ends there as the coffee is not great. My husband got drip and said it tasted like Keurig coffee. I got a latte and there was no microfoam (just bubbles) and it just didn’t taste great. It was drinkable, but there are so many other great options if you really want a good cup of coffee. I also got a muffin and the girl heated it up in a tiny toaster oven. The top had started to burn while the bottom was somehow still cold.
